10. YouTube Videos

This website embeds videos from YouTube (Google Ireland Limited, Gordon House, Barrow Street, Dublin 4, Ireland). We use exclusively the enhanced privacy mode (youtube-nocookie.com).

In enhanced privacy mode, no cookies are set and no data is transmitted to YouTube as long as you do not actively play the video. Only after clicking Play will a connection to YouTube servers be established and your IP address and usage data transmitted.

Legal basis: Art. 6(1)(a) GDPR (consent obtained via Borlabs Cookie prior to activation of the video player)

We use a two-click solution (e.g. Shariff), meaning that simply viewing a page will transmit no data to any social network. A connection to the respective platform is only established when you actively click a share button. Only then will data such as your IP address and the visited URL be transmitted to the respective provider.

Legal basis: Art. 6(1)(a) GDPR (consent by actively clicking)

7. CONTROLS FOR DO-NOT-TRACK FEATURES

Most web browsers and some mobile operating systems and mobile applications include a Do-Not-Track (“DNT”) feature or setting you can activate to signal your privacy preference not to have data about your online browsing activities monitored and collected. At this stage, no uniform technology standard for recognizing and implementing DNT signals has been finalized. As such, we do not currently respond to DNT browser signals or any other mechanism that automatically communicates your choice not to be tracked online. If a standard for online tracking is adopted that we must follow in the future, we will inform you about that practice in a revised version of this Privacy Notice.

California law requires us to let you know how we respond to web browser DNT signals. Because there currently is not an industry or legal standard for recognizing or honoring DNT signals, we do not respond to them at this time.

California “Shine The Light” Law

California Civil Code Section 1798.83, also known as the “Shine The Light” law, permits our users who are California residents to request and obtain from us, once a year and free of charge, information about categories of personal information (if any) we disclosed to third parties for direct marketing purposes and the names and addresses of all third parties with which we shared personal information in the immediately preceding calendar year.
